Output 24893660dce51d266927364c8ad25331255846b6d09549b3821a90173b802723:62
- value
- 525993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f794cfc8fd4747a86fe2a1c0fec72a304db9a02d OP_EQUAL
- address
- 3QG76YME6u4YCSLSG8TYTaZnKVPVmBa1zq
- transaction
- 24893660dce51d266927364c8ad25331255846b6d09549b3821a90173b802723
- spent
- true